Web服务器端口号的默认设置是基于其所使用的传输协议而定的,不同协议下,Web服务器监听的默认端口存在差异,这些端口号用于接受和处理来自客户端的请求,以提供相应的Web服务,下面将依据不同协议及应用,详细介绍各个默认端口及其作用:
1、HTTP协议
默认端口号:当使用HTTP(超文本传输协议)时,Web服务器的默认端口号为80,这意味着当客户端仅指定服务器地址而没有明确端口号时,HTTP请求会自动发送至服务器的80端口,这样的设计大大方便了用户访问网站的过程,无需在URL中显式指定端口号即可访问服务器上的网页数据。
工作原理:HTTP协议是基于请求响应模式的,客户端发送请求到服务器的80端口,服务器接收到请求后返回相应的网页内容,这一过程完全依赖于默认端口号80,确保了数据传输的顺畅进行。
2、HTTPS协议
默认端口号:对于HTTPS(安全传输网页的协议),其默认端口号为443,HTTPS不仅保证了数据传输的安全性,同时也提供了一种标准方法,使得Web服务器能够通过特定的端口与客户端建立加密通信连接。
安全性分析:HTTPS协议通过SSL/TLS协议对数据进行加密,保障了数据传输过程中的安全,当用户访问涉及敏感信息的网页(如在线支付、账户登录等)时,使用默认的443端口可以确保信息不被轻易窃取或篡改。
3、Telnet协议
默认端口号:虽然Telnet(不安全的文本传送协议)已逐渐被更安全的远程连接方式取代,但其默认端口号仍为23,Telnet协议允许用户在远程服务器上执行命令,但因为其传输的数据未加密,所以存在安全隐患。
使用限制:考虑到安全性问题,现代Web服务器很少使用Telnet协议作为主要的远程管理手段,尽管如此,了解其默认端口仍然对网络管理员有一定的意义,特别是在需要对旧系统进行维护时。
Web服务器的端口号默认设置与其所使用的传输协议密切相关,不同的协议有着各自的默认端口,HTTP的默认端口号为80,HTTPS为443,而Telnet则是23,每种端口号的设计都有其特定的用途和考量,了解这些默认端口号,不仅可以优化Web服务器的配置和管理,还能更好地理解网络安全和数据传输的基本机制。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1038872.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复